NOC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

1,251 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Northrop Grumman (NOC)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$50.1B — up 6.8% from $46.9B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 167 funds opened new NOC positions and 91 closed out — a net gain of 76 holders — while 439 added to existing stakes and 394 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Ameriprise, adding an estimated $426M. The largest seller was Capital International Investors, cutting an estimated $348M.
